Build rust from source
WebJan 10, 2024 · You can build a Rust module that can be called directly from Node.js without needing to create a child process like esbuild. Rust + WebAssembly WebAssembly (WASM) is a portable low-level language that Rust can compile to. It runs in the browser, is interoperable with JavaScript and is supported in all major modern browsers. WebThe Rust compiler is always invoked with a single source file as input, and always produces a single output crate. The processing of that source file may result in other source files …
Build rust from source
Did you know?
WebOct 11, 2024 · The three build-system supported source-generation use cases are generating C bindings using bindgen, AIDL interfaces, and protobuf interfaces. Crates … WebAug 2, 2024 · app. First, launch a command prompt ( cmd.exe ), and cd to a folder where you want to keep your Rust projects. Then ask Cargo to create a new Rust project for …
WebChromium's Clang build process leaves behind several artifacts needed for the Rust build. Each Rust build begins after a Clang build and uses these artifacts, which include clang, LLVM libraries, etc. A special CI job is used to build Clang and Rust from the revisions specified in the Chromium source tree. These are uploaded to a storage bucket. WebNov 3, 2024 · In issue #86436, @Mark-Simulacrum commented:. FWIW we don't generally expect people to use x.py build in dist tarballs -- x.py dist/install are more likely to work. I …
WebTo start using Rust, download the installer, then run the program and follow the onscreen instructions. You may need to install the Visual Studio C++ Build tools when prompted to … Webruby-build is a command-line tool that simplifies installation of any Ruby version from source on Unix-like systems. It is available as a plugin for rbenv as the rbenv install command, or as a standalone program as the ruby-build command. Installation Homebrew package manager brew install ruby-build Upgrade with: brew upgrade ruby-build
WebCustomizing the Build Speeding up the Build Using Docker in your Build Headless Testing with Browsers Building Pull Requests Cron Jobs Common Build Problems Command Line Client Build Config Imports Build Config Validation Jobs, Builds, Matrices and Stages Job Lifecycle Build Matrix Build Stages Conditional Builds, Stages, and Jobs
WebIf you want to compile cryptography yourself you’ll need a C compiler, a Rust compiler, headers for Python (if you’re not using pypy ), and headers for the OpenSSL and libffi libraries available on your system. On all Linux distributions you will need to have Rust installed and available. Alpine Warning can you add honey to kefirWebMar 3, 2024 · Building and running Rust by hand. Start with a simple program that prints "Hello, world!" on the screen. Open your favorite text editor and type the following program: $ cat hello.rs fn main () { println! … can you add hotspot data to verizonWebThe best option is to install the Rust toolchain using rustup your Rust toolchain. FreeBSD As root or with sudo, run: pkg install -y \ ` # install tools` \ gmake cmake pkgconf py38-pip python38 \ ` # install clamav dependencies` \ bzip2 check curl json-c libmilter libxml2 ncurses pcre2 Now as a regular user, run: briefing crewWebApr 11, 2024 · South Side Rep. Marcus Evans introduced a bill in February to create a “Rust Belt to Green Belt” fund in support of an offshore wind project in Lake Michigan that … can you add htv to nylonWebRust in Visual Studio Code. Rust is a powerful programming language, often used for systems programming where performance and correctness are high priorities. If you are new to Rust and want to learn more, The Rust Programming Language online book is a great place to start. This topic goes into detail about setting up and using Rust within Visual … can you add honey to whiskeyWebdebhelper buildsystem for Rust crates using Cargo adep: cargo Rust package manager adep: rustc Rust systems programming language adep: libstd-rust-dev Rust standard libraries - development files adep: librust-base64-0.13+default-dev Package not available adep: librust-bytes-1+default-dev briefing database weekly back up ey.comWebDec 25, 2024 · This is caused by the crash of internal package (say cargo) we can solve this by following the steps. Please clear the cargo registry. rm -rf … can you add hydrogen peroxide to water